Today we are taking a look back at Our Daily Bread Designs November Release, here is the card/project I created using ODBD – Jesus Loves You Stamp/Die Duos set, ODBD Custom Die – Snowflake SkyODBD Snowflake Season Collection – 6×6 paper pad, and ODBD Custom Die – Stitched Ovals.

For the sentiment label, I die cut a white cardstock with one of the ODBD Custom Die – Stitched Ovals and then embossed it with the same die. Then I stamped the sentiment from the ODBD – Jesus Loves You Stamp/Die Duos set on the oval die cut with Red mini ink pad. I die cut one of the patterned paper from ODBD Snowflake Season Collection – 6×6 paper pad with the Jesus die cut that comes from the ODBD – Jesus Loves You Stamp/Die Duos set. Also, before I remove the die cut of the die, I run it through again my machine to embossed it. Love the extra texture on it after the embossing. Then I added the die cut Jesus on the label base with Liquid Glass glue.

For the background paper, I used the ODBD Snowflake Season Collection – 6×6 paper pad. I cut it into 4.25″ x 5.5″ and added it on the A2 card base. And then I die cut a piece of silver foil paper (DCWV) with the ODBD Custom Die – Snowflake Sky, and then embossed it with the same die for extra texture on them. I added the die cut background on the card base with Liquid Glass glue (CTMH).

After creating the background, I added the label I made on the card with 3D foam tape. I decided not to add any embellishments because I want the Jesus and the Bible verse be the center of the card. And I think the snowflake patterned paper and foil snowflake sky die cut give the extra bling on it already 🙂
